Axentis is a provider of enterprise governance, risk and compliance (GRC) software.[1]
Axentis Enterprise boasts the world's largest GRC user group, finding use in over 100 countries.[2] With over 50,000 Sarbanes-Oxley users, Axentis Enterprise is also the world's most widely adopted Sarbanes-Oxley solution.[3]
Gartner named Axentis to its “Cool Vendors in IT Services and Outsourcing 2006” in its Feb 2006 report for application of SaaS to compliance management.[4]
